The HP OfficeJet 6950 is a reliable all-in-one printer, but many users encounter a frustrating roadblock: "Cartridge Problem" or "Non-HP Chip Detected" errors. These messages typically appear after an automatic firmware update designed to block third-party or refilled ink cartridges. To regain the ability to use more affordable ink options, you must perform a firmware downgrade.
